Mary Drexler

May 25, 1916 — January 14, 2004

BLUE EARTHJanuary 14, 2004Mary DrexlerMary was born May 25, 1916, in Emmetsburg, Iowa, the daughter of Joseph W. and Mary "Annie" (Cullen) Mulroney.Mary was raised and graduated from St. Mary''s Academy in Emmetsburg, Iowa.. She studied business at Lours College in Dubuque for one year and Emmetsburg Community College for one year. She married John J. Berry and he preceded her in death in 1944. In 1952 she moved to Blue Earth. On Feb. 26, 1952 she married Dr. George W. Drexler at Collegeville, Minnesota.. She was a homemaker and bookkeeper for many years. Dr. George W. Drexler preceded her in death in 1991. She was a member of SS. Peter & Paul Catholic Church, active in the local, county, state, & national Democratic Party, Blue Earth Valley Concert Assn., American Heart Assn., awarded Outstanding City Chairperson in 1974 and Gold Star Wife.She is survived by her Son: Daniel (& wife Chris) Drexler, Coon Rapids, Son: Michael Berry, Rapid City, SDakota, Son: Fred (& wife Susan) Drexler, Lakeville, Daughter: Mary Frances Conway, St. Paul. Daughter: Anna Marie Drexler, Seattle, WAashington, niece: Jean Drew, Cylinder, Iowa, niece: Susan Malynn, Tucson, Arizona, niece: Ann Johnson, Denver, Colorado, eleven grandchildren, one great grandchild, three great nieces and 2 great nephews. She was preceded in death by her parents, Two husbands, Sons-Paul & John T. Drexler, Nephew-Mark Schrichte, Two Brothers & 1 sister.
